Latest Patents

Among her latest patents are innovative compounds such as "3,5-dioxo-(2H,4H)-1,2,4-triazine derivatives as 5HT.sub.1A ligands" and "Derivatives of 1,2-dihydro 2-oxo quinoxalines, their preparation." These inventions showcase her expertise in creating new chemical entities that may have important applications in treating various medical conditions.
